Step by Step Method

Step 1

Boil eggs for approx 8 minutes and cool.

Step 2

Peel eggs and mash with a fork, add the curry powder, chives and mayonnaise and spread egg mixture onto 4 slices of bread.

Step 3

Top the egg mix with the other 4 slices and cut as desired.
